| Project Name: | Liquid Natural Gas-Compressed Natural Gas Fueling Station |
| Location: | Dallas, Texas |
| Project Description: | This project included design services for modifications to existing facilities for the operation and maintenance of LNG-fueled buses. |
| Paragon's Role: | As the
Prime Design Consultant to DART, Paragon provided services for the preparation
of plans and specifications for an LNG/CNG Fueling Station. In Phase I,
PARAGON prepared a written determination of the impact on the existing DART
Northwest Facility for maintaining and fueling LNG-fueled transit buses.
This report included a study of revisions, modification, and replacements
of the HVAC Systems, Electrical Distribution and Associated Equipment, Fire
Protection Systems, Fuel Dispensing and Vapor Recovery Facilities, Fuel
Storage, and Maintenance Equipment. During Phase II, PARAGON designed two 30,000-gallon cryogenic storage tanks with cryogenic piping, pumps, controls, regulators and dispensing devices. Included was the design of canopy structures, fueled dispensing islands, venting systems, and integration of LNG/CNG fueling and existing "Fleetwatch" hardware and software management system. PARAGON will provide a complete training program to be coordinated with DART's Risk Management/Quality Assurance and design services during bid/award and construction phases of the project. |
